(a)In general The Secretary shall carry out a comprehensive national program, including advertising and media awareness, to inform consumers about—
(1)the need to reduce energy consumption during the 4-year period beginning on August 8, 2005;
(2)the benefits to consumers of reducing consumption of electricity, natural gas, and petroleum, particularly during peak use periods;
(3)the importance of low energy costs to economic growth and preserving manufacturing jobs in the United States; and
(4)practical, cost-effective measures that consumers can take to reduce consumption of electricity, natural gas, and gasoline, including—
(A)maintaining and repairing heating and cooling ducts and equipment;
(B)weatherizing homes and buildings;
(C)purchasing energy efficient products; and
